2025年,日本非鐵金屬市場規模達399億美元。 IMARC Group預測,到2034年,該市場規模將達到600億美元,2026年至2034年的複合年成長率為4.65%。推動市場成長的關鍵因素包括製造業需求的成長、電子和可再生能源領域的技術創新、建設產業的蓬勃發展、對永續性和回收的重視以及電動車的普及。

非鐵金屬是指不含鐵的金屬,因此不具有磁性。此類別包含多種元素和合金,其中最常見的有鋁、銅、鉛、鋅、鎳以及金、銀等貴金屬。與含鐵且易生鏽的黑色金屬相比,非鐵金屬具有耐腐蝕性,使其在各種應用領域都極具價值。它們優異的性能,例如重量輕、導電性高(銅和鋁)以及耐腐蝕性,使其廣泛應用於建築、汽車製造、電子和航太等領域。此外,非鐵金屬也是製造日常用品(如電線、管道、硬幣和珠寶飾品)的重要組成部分。有色金屬的可回收性使其更加重要,這符合全球永續資源管理和減少環境影響的努力。非鐵金屬的多功能性和優異的性能使其成為現代工業流程中非鐵金屬的組成部分,並在推動技術進步和永續發展方面發揮關鍵作用。

日本非鐵金屬市場趨勢:

日本蓬勃發展的製造業,從汽車到電子產品,都高度依賴鋁、銅等非鐵金屬,而有色金屬正是推動市場成長的主要動力。此外,日本大力推動技術創新,尤其是在電子和可再生能源領域,促使先進零件和設備的生產對非鐵金屬的需求不斷成長,從而促進了市場擴張。同時,建設產業的強勁表現也顯著提升了電線、管道和結構件等應用領域對非鐵金屬的需求,進一步支撐了市場成長。此外,日本對永續性和環境保護的承諾也強調了非鐵金屬回收的重要性,進一步推動了市場擴張。同時,全球電動車(EV)的普及也帶動了鋰、鎳、鈷等電池製造必需的非鐵金屬需求激增,進一步推動了市場成長。此外,日本為減少碳排放和推廣綠色技術所做的努力刺激了可再生能源產業的成長,進一步推動了太陽能板和風力發電機對非鐵金屬的需求。同時,日本在全球貴金屬市場(包括黃金和白銀)的關鍵地位,以及這些貴金屬在珠寶飾品、電子產品和投資領域的廣泛應用,也促進了市場的擴張。除此之外,基礎建設的不斷推進,刺激了橋樑、機場和其他關鍵設施建設所需的非鐵金屬需求,為市場成長提供了巨大的機會。

Japan non-ferrous metals market size reached USD 39.9 Billion in 2025 . Looking forward, IMARC Group expects the market to reach USD 60.0 Billion by 2034 , exhibiting a growth rate (CAGR) of 4.65% during 2026-2034 . The increasing demand from the manufacturing sector, technological innovation in electronics and renewable energy, thriving construction industry, emphasis on sustainability and recycling, and rise of electric vehicles (EVs) represent some of the key factors driving the market.

Non-ferrous metals are metals that do not contain iron and, consequently, lack magnetic properties. This category includes a diverse range of elements and alloys, with some of the most common being aluminum, copper, lead, zinc, nickel , and precious metals like gold and silver. Compared to ferrous metals, which contain iron and are susceptible to rust, non-ferrous metals exhibit corrosion resistance, making them valuable for various applications. These metals find extensive use in industries such as construction, automotive manufacturing, electronics, and aerospace due to their desirable properties, such as lightweight nature, high conductivity (in the case of copper and aluminum), and resistance to corrosion. Moreover, non-ferrous metals are crucial components in the production of everyday items like wiring, pipes, coins, and jewelry. The recyclability of non-ferrous metals further contributes to their importance, aligning with global efforts toward sustainable resource management and reducing environmental impact. The versatility and advantageous characteristics of non-ferrous metals make them indispensable in modern industrial processes and play a vital role in shaping technological advancements and sustainable practices.

JAPAN NON-FERROUS METALS MARKET TRENDS:

The thriving manufacturing sector in Japan, ranging from automotive to electronics, relies heavily on non-ferrous metals such as aluminum and copper, which is primarily driving the market growth. Besides this, the country's dedication to technological innovation, especially in the electronics and renewable energy sectors, has led to increased consumption of non-ferrous metals for the production of advanced components and devices, creating a positive outlook for the market expansion. Moreover, the construction industry's robust performance has contributed significantly to the demand for non-ferrous metals in applications like wiring, piping, and structural components, thereby strengthening the market growth. In confluence with this, Japan's commitment to sustainability and environmental responsibility has accentuated the importance of recycling non-ferrous metals, aiding in market expansion. Concurrently, the global trend towards electric vehicles (EVs) has driven a surge in demand for non-ferrous metals like lithium, nickel, and cobalt, essential components in the manufacturing of batteries, thereby providing an impetus to the market growth. In addition to this, the country's efforts to reduce carbon emissions and promote green technologies have stimulated growth in the renewable energy sector, subsequently fueling the demand for non-ferrous metals for solar panels and wind turbines. Furthermore, Japan's status as a significant player in the global precious metals market, including gold and silver, has been buoyed by their applications in jewelry, electronics, and investment, which, in turn, is contributing to the market's expansion. Apart from this, the expanding infrastructure development spurring the demand for non-ferrous metals, as they are essential in the construction of bridges, airports, and other critical structures, is presenting lucrative opportunities for the market growth.
